5235f24cdc6bb4add5bfeeb8f7551aa355f3f9fb: Merge m-c to graphics, a=merge
Kartikaya Gupta <kgupta@mozilla.com> - Tue, 30 May 2017 07:50:05 -0400 - rev 361248
Push 31921 by ryanvm@gmail.com at Tue, 30 May 2017 16:13:51 +0000
Merge m-c to graphics, a=merge MozReview-Commit-ID: IU4SJ95MVHH
392436e4adff730e3d8da332bcde199bd1151a7b: Bug 1366915 part 2 - Make CompositorBridgeChild allocate pipeline id for async image pipeline r=nical
sotaro <sotaro.ikeda.g@gmail.com> - Tue, 30 May 2017 09:59:44 +0900 - rev 361247
Push 31921 by ryanvm@gmail.com at Tue, 30 May 2017 16:13:51 +0000
Bug 1366915 part 2 - Make CompositorBridgeChild allocate pipeline id for async image pipeline r=nical
9fb4a2607ce1199d49f06ed6843b81138a60eb28: Bug 1366915 part 1 - Remove pipeline id allocation with IPC MozPromise r=nical
sotaro <sotaro.ikeda.g@gmail.com> - Tue, 30 May 2017 09:59:29 +0900 - rev 361246
Push 31921 by ryanvm@gmail.com at Tue, 30 May 2017 16:13:51 +0000
Bug 1366915 part 1 - Remove pipeline id allocation with IPC MozPromise r=nical
cd4f49d7d26ea65c85913963c7cde4216f4fb911: Bug 1368487 - Fix content rect passed to scroll layers to be relative to the right thing. r=jrmuizel
Kartikaya Gupta <kgupta@mozilla.com> - Mon, 29 May 2017 11:40:58 -0400 - rev 361245
Push 31921 by ryanvm@gmail.com at Tue, 30 May 2017 16:13:51 +0000
Bug 1368487 - Fix content rect passed to scroll layers to be relative to the right thing. r=jrmuizel MozReview-Commit-ID: 1mbVLqp9o2R
036bb590845037c33c14c5a1e9dc25b2c4311d4e: Bug 1368487 - Add some default-disabled logging functionality to WebRenderAPI.cpp r=jrmuizel
Kartikaya Gupta <kgupta@mozilla.com> - Mon, 29 May 2017 11:40:49 -0400 - rev 361244
Push 31921 by ryanvm@gmail.com at Tue, 30 May 2017 16:13:51 +0000
Bug 1368487 - Add some default-disabled logging functionality to WebRenderAPI.cpp r=jrmuizel MozReview-Commit-ID: DAqeAEyjCTm
4e09f53bcb573e833908497bdb3013fc295f94ab: Bug 1367911 - Follow-up to remove invalid assertion. r=me
Kartikaya Gupta <kgupta@mozilla.com> - Mon, 29 May 2017 09:57:42 -0400 - rev 361243
Push 31921 by ryanvm@gmail.com at Tue, 30 May 2017 16:13:51 +0000
Bug 1367911 - Follow-up to remove invalid assertion. r=me MozReview-Commit-ID: IdL5yLgserF
73a610ae4080b4598337654d6344d184e915f18c: Merge m-c to graphics, a=merge
Kartikaya Gupta <kgupta@mozilla.com> - Mon, 29 May 2017 08:28:04 -0400 - rev 361242
Push 31921 by ryanvm@gmail.com at Tue, 30 May 2017 16:13:51 +0000
Merge m-c to graphics, a=merge MozReview-Commit-ID: 8IWAJNO52ry
577082fce7bf8cd2eefdfad0078438a6d47fe14f: Bug 1367911 - Extract a GetLayersId() helper. r=dvander
Kartikaya Gupta <kgupta@mozilla.com> - Sun, 28 May 2017 07:51:53 -0400 - rev 361241
Push 31921 by ryanvm@gmail.com at Tue, 30 May 2017 16:13:51 +0000
Bug 1367911 - Extract a GetLayersId() helper. r=dvander We're calling this often enough that it seems good to extract a named helper method. MozReview-Commit-ID: gIwdyfafOq
a7a313dc31abd2662b4971089fe6c78b9dcb45ac: Bug 1367911 - Update APZCCallbackHelper to support WebRender. r=dvander
Kartikaya Gupta <kgupta@mozilla.com> - Sun, 28 May 2017 07:51:51 -0400 - rev 361240
Push 31921 by ryanvm@gmail.com at Tue, 30 May 2017 16:13:51 +0000
Bug 1367911 - Update APZCCallbackHelper to support WebRender. r=dvander This allows APZCCallbackHelper to send the SetConfirmedTargetAPZC message over PWebRenderBridge if webrender is enabled, rather than assuming the layer manager is a ClientLayerManager and then crashing. MozReview-Commit-ID: 57o9CaCcbTi
1d0c58e01f4dea654b4b84b6e3ae3ed3fedecd34: Bug 1367911 - Refactor the SetConfirmedTargetAPZC function to take a layers id. r=dvander
Kartikaya Gupta <kgupta@mozilla.com> - Sun, 28 May 2017 07:51:48 -0400 - rev 361239
Push 31921 by ryanvm@gmail.com at Tue, 30 May 2017 16:13:51 +0000
Bug 1367911 - Refactor the SetConfirmedTargetAPZC function to take a layers id. r=dvander This makes it simpler to reuse this API from WebRenderBridgeParent, since we can provide a layers id but not a LayerTransactionParent. MozReview-Commit-ID: DEIGMk9tJEB
9c246299ad82f23c3c28acadeee0d1ff7f1d1111: Bug 1367837 - Implement some APZ test util APIs for webrender. r=botond,dvander
Kartikaya Gupta <kgupta@mozilla.com> - Sun, 28 May 2017 07:48:36 -0400 - rev 361238
Push 31921 by ryanvm@gmail.com at Tue, 30 May 2017 16:13:51 +0000
Bug 1367837 - Implement some APZ test util APIs for webrender. r=botond,dvander This implements some methods exposed on DOMWindowUtils and used by reftests, for the WebRender codepath. The implementation is very similar to the implementation in LayerTransactionParent. MozReview-Commit-ID: HP8OxzIzS7P
db86dd808a1abdeed8459045e055f20236b486c3: Bug 1367837 - Expose a testing helper method to get an APZC instance from the layers id and scroll id. r=botond
Kartikaya Gupta <kgupta@mozilla.com> - Sun, 28 May 2017 07:48:33 -0400 - rev 361237
Push 31921 by ryanvm@gmail.com at Tue, 30 May 2017 16:13:51 +0000
Bug 1367837 - Expose a testing helper method to get an APZC instance from the layers id and scroll id. r=botond MozReview-Commit-ID: HyEMamx7nDk
b657891b5b02a8c948a02068bc05102e7c0cbfb9: Bug 1367837 - Have the CompositorBridgeParent::FlushApzRepaints function take a layers id instead of a layer tree. r=dvander
Kartikaya Gupta <kgupta@mozilla.com> - Sun, 28 May 2017 07:48:29 -0400 - rev 361236
Push 31921 by ryanvm@gmail.com at Tue, 30 May 2017 16:13:51 +0000
Bug 1367837 - Have the CompositorBridgeParent::FlushApzRepaints function take a layers id instead of a layer tree. r=dvander This is helpful for reusing the FlushApzRepaints from WebRenderBridgeParent, since it no longer assumes there's a layers transaction object. MozReview-Commit-ID: GVqDDEeZaN3
55d3640b8a2db961e50bcfe676e478a6bccfeccf: Merge m-c to graphics, a=merge
Kartikaya Gupta <kgupta@mozilla.com> - Fri, 26 May 2017 08:28:53 -0400 - rev 361235
Push 31921 by ryanvm@gmail.com at Tue, 30 May 2017 16:13:51 +0000
Merge m-c to graphics, a=merge MozReview-Commit-ID: 91TVUCwwNt4
25c281fca778ac22d64857128e426a43fa6543e3: Bug 1367870 - Add stringification helper for WrRect. r=jrmuizel
Kartikaya Gupta <kgupta@mozilla.com> - Thu, 25 May 2017 17:49:30 -0400 - rev 361234
Push 31921 by ryanvm@gmail.com at Tue, 30 May 2017 16:13:51 +0000
Bug 1367870 - Add stringification helper for WrRect. r=jrmuizel MozReview-Commit-ID: FMw6tPI2LOJ
8f762279e32cc257acbc851ae2cfeb0020ce8e3b: Bug 1367870 - Remove unused logging function bodies. r=jrmuizel
Kartikaya Gupta <kgupta@mozilla.com> - Thu, 25 May 2017 17:49:23 -0400 - rev 361233
Push 31921 by ryanvm@gmail.com at Tue, 30 May 2017 16:13:51 +0000
Bug 1367870 - Remove unused logging function bodies. r=jrmuizel Both nsIntPoint and IntRect are specializations of template classes (BasePoint and BaseRect) that are already covered by the corresponding template methods in LayersLogging.h. Therefore these methods are not needed (and in fact are not listed separately in LayersLogging.h). MozReview-Commit-ID: BIZAOFfWCfI
3d821b8e5cbf1c250c476648b43b146d65087082: Bug 1365934 - Update webrender to 76a3213080ca5c2e2a612c3023c50c81a111fd55. r=jrmuizel,kvark
Kartikaya Gupta <kgupta@mozilla.com> - Thu, 25 May 2017 13:27:55 -0400 - rev 361232
Push 31921 by ryanvm@gmail.com at Tue, 30 May 2017 16:13:51 +0000
Bug 1365934 - Update webrender to 76a3213080ca5c2e2a612c3023c50c81a111fd55. r=jrmuizel,kvark This includes a change to bindings.rs for an API change to the readback function in webrender cset 052b0a7. MozReview-Commit-ID: K9eMrF3O6OX
1a0568ebe975cafcd2f8e785730a2a13d5ee9a9e: Bug 1365495 - Let WebRender premultiply gradient stop colors r=jrmuizel
Ryan Hunt <rhunt@eqrion.net> - Thu, 18 May 2017 20:30:15 -0400 - rev 361231
Push 31921 by ryanvm@gmail.com at Tue, 30 May 2017 16:13:51 +0000
Bug 1365495 - Let WebRender premultiply gradient stop colors r=jrmuizel WebRender now expects a non-premultiplied gradient stop color in the API.
9c8bcb590b888c5c077e3a05625800ed0d6786a8: Merge m-c to graphics, a=merge
Kartikaya Gupta <kgupta@mozilla.com> - Thu, 25 May 2017 08:06:56 -0400 - rev 361230
Push 31921 by ryanvm@gmail.com at Tue, 30 May 2017 16:13:51 +0000
Merge m-c to graphics, a=merge MozReview-Commit-ID: 3cEYFBtGvTZ
e4db9580e41b486ee1dbd603bd2e011003f5fb1f: Merge m-c to graphics, a=merge
Kartikaya Gupta <kgupta@mozilla.com> - Wed, 24 May 2017 08:14:30 -0400 - rev 361229
Push 31921 by ryanvm@gmail.com at Tue, 30 May 2017 16:13:51 +0000
Merge m-c to graphics, a=merge MozReview-Commit-ID: 2pUMxaNAKCC
(0) -300000 -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 +100000 tip